Early Life

Soleil Errico was born on December 20, 2000, in the beautiful beach town of Malibu, California. Entry into the Surfing World

In 2015, Soleil made her debut in the competitive surfing scene when she participated in the Miss Malibu Pro 2015 Championship. Rise to Prominence

As Soleil continued to compete in various Longboard championships, she caught the attention of renowned brands such as Stewart Surfboards and Janga Wetsuits. Securing sponsorships from these industry giants was a significant milestone in her career, allowing her to focus on honing her craft and pushing the boundaries of what was possible in the world of Longboard surfing.

Throughout her competitive career, Soleil has amassed an impressive collection of surf titles, showcasing her exceptional talent and determination. In 2017, she claimed victory as the USA Surfing Women's Longboard National Champion, solidifying her status as one of the top surfers in the country. Additionally, she clinched the WSA Women's Longboard California State Championships in both 2016 and 2017, further cementing her reputation as a force to be reckoned with in the surfing world.
